Top 3 Best Morton County Public Middle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there are 3 public middle schools serving 152 students in Morton County, KS.
The top ranked public middle schools in Morton County, KS are Rolla Jh/hs (6-12) and Elkhart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Morton County, KS public middle schools have an average math proficiency score of 18% (versus the Kansas public middle school average of 24%), and reading proficiency score of 24% (versus the 28% statewide average). Middle schools in Morton County have an average ranking of 4/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Kansas public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 51%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Kansas public middle school average of 35% (majority Hispanic).
